The occupants were able to get out of the vehicle before it caught fire and spread to brush nearby. Medic engine 25 and us forest service arrived on scene and were able to put the fire out quickly. Good Samaritans were also seen putting water on fire before fire department arrived.It is unknown at this time if any patients were treated or transported. California Highway Patrol is conducting the investigation. Don’s Auto recovered the Vehicle. Highway 18 which was closed to one lane for a short period is back open.
